Education and Development Team Administrator

Job summary

The Education and Development Team plays a vital role in supporting the learning, development and professional growth of colleagues across NSFT. We are responsible for coordinating and delivering a wide range of education and training opportunities, ensuring staff have access to the knowledge, skills and resources they need to provide outstanding care.

As a Team Administrator, you will carry out a variety of administrative tasks that support the efficient day-to-day running of the Trust's education and training services. A key part of the role will involve welcoming and supporting course delegates at our Hellesdon training facilities, providing reception duties and ensuring visitors receive a professional and positive experience. You will also work closely with trainers and facilitators, assisting with training room set-up, resources and basic IT queries to help training sessions run smoothly.

Main duties of the job

Working within the Education & Development Team, you will provide a wide range of administrative support to help ensure services run efficiently and effectively. You will be a key point of contact for staff, managing enquiries through the team inbox and telephone service, providing information, responding to queries and directing requests as appropriate.

The role includes setting up learning activities on ESR, producing reports, supporting the funded training request process, maintaining accurate records, raising requisitions through the Trust procurement system and helping to monitor and support the effective use of the Trust's training budget. You will also assist with the maintenance and development of Education & Development intranet content, ensuring staff have access to up-to-date information and learning resources.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website.

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ants.
